PAKISTAN: ECONOMY

Pakistan’s economy is almost on emergency mode; nobody’s worried!

During Jan-Oct FY08, imports of food stood near to $3.5 billion, fertiliser $823 million and fuel, a gigantic $8.6 billion. With the global oil and food price rise, and growing political instability, Pakistan might just be on the road to an economic disaster. And the warning signs are already on alarm mode. There has been a drastic reduction in fertiliser production as well as wheat produce. Add to this the over 17% oil budget rise, which happened solely because of the global oil price increase. An economic collapse is not a rare phenomenon if one sees developing nations, the most recent being Zimbabwe. Pakistan seems to be mirroring almost all the issues that plagued Zimbabwe. Sadly, all that remains now is for the fire alarm to blow!

‘Kingdom of God is within you’

Peace, pride and prosperity can’t be imposed, bought or sold

The maxim, “the Rabbit that stays in a hole must be ready to face the hunter’s fire,” aptly defines the problems that most of poor African and Asian countries encounter. And if the World Bank floods these poor economies with aids, they will remain poor in the next century. The world has to realise that poverty, health, money are not problems of Africa. It is their failure to realise their own role to come out from the anarchy and shame. Aids, donations and sympathy from the developed world have never helped them; these have in fact, made them more dependent to godfathers, colonisers and aid giving countries.

The only continent blessed with natural resources, comprising of petroleum, diamond, metals; Africa failed to reap off these. If godfathers are only to be blamed; then South Korea, India faced much traumatic, horrifying, colonial history. Still, S. Korea is 30 times richer than Zimbabwe in terms of PPP. The crux of the problem is exclusively on poor quality of governance.
